| Specification | Tecno Camon 19 Pro | Vivo Y50i |
|---|---|---|
| Price in Pakistan | ||
| Retail price | PKR 49,999 Cheaper | PKR 57,999 |
| Design & build | ||
| Release date | July 2022 | June 2020 (Pakistan) |
| Dimensions | 166.8 × 74.6 × 8.6 mm | 162.0 × 76.6 × 8.9 mm |
| Weight | Approx. 204 g | 199 g Better |
| Water resistance | No official IP certification | No official IP rating |
| Display | ||
| Screen size | 6.8 inches Better | 6.53 inches |
| Resolution | 1080 × 2460 pixels (FHD+) Better | 720 × 1600 pixels (~270 ppi) |
| Panel type | IPS LCD 120Hz 16.7 million colors Adaptive refresh rate Multi-touch support Excellent viewing angles Smooth scrolling and gaming experience | IPS LCD |
| Protection | Not officially specified | Scratch-resistant glass |
| Performance | ||
| Chipset | MediaTek Helio G96 (12nm) | Qualcomm Snapdragon 665 (11 nm) |
| CPU | Octa-core 2 × Cortex-A76 @ 2.05 GHz 6 × Cortex-A55 @ 2.0 GHz | Octa-core (4×2.0 GHz Kryo 260 Gold + 4×1.8 GHz Kryo 260 Silver) |
| GPU | Mali-G57 MC2 | Adreno 610 |
| Operating system | Android 12 with HIOS 8.6 | Android 10 (Funtouch OS 10) |
| Memory & storage | ||
| RAM | 8GB Better | 4 GB |
| Internal storage | 128GB UFS 2.2 Better | 64 GB |
| Card slot | microSDXC (Dedicated Slot) | microSDXC (dedicated slot) |
| Camera | ||
| Main camera | 64 MP, f/1.8, Wide, PDAF, OIS 50 MP, Telephoto, PDAF, 2x Optical Zoom 2 MP, Depth Sensor Quad-LED Flash HDR Panorama Portrait Mode AI Scene Detection Night Mode Better | 8 MP wide + 2 MP depth |
| Selfie camera | 32 MP Wide Camera Dual-LED Flash HDR Better | 8 MP wide |
| Video recording | 1080p @ 30fps | 1080p@30fps |
| Battery & charging | ||
| Battery capacity | Li-Ion (non-removable) 5000 mAh | Non-removable Li-Po 5000 mAh |
| Wired charging | 33W Fast Charging 100% in approximately 65 minutes (advertised) Better | 10W wired |
| Connectivity & extras | ||
| SIM | Dual Nano-SIM, Dual Standby | Dual SIM (Nano-SIM, dual standby) |
| Wi-Fi | Wi-Fi 802.11 a/b/g/n/ac Dual-band Wi-Fi Wi-Fi Direct | Wi-Fi 802.11 b/g/n |
| Bluetooth | 5.1 | 5.0 |
| NFC | No | No |
| Sensors | Side-mounted Fingerprint Scanner Accelerometer Proximity Sensor Ambient Light Sensor | Fingerprint (rear-mounted), accelerometer, proximity, compass |
| USB | USB Type-C 2.0, OTG | microUSB 2.0, OTG |

Tecno Camon 19 Pro comes out ahead on our combined spec score, leading by 3.2 points. It wins on camera, battery & charging, memory & storage and value for money. Vivo Y50i can still be the better buy if your priorities sit elsewhere or if you find it at a lower street price.
Tecno Camon 19 Pro is listed at PKR 49,999 and Vivo Y50i at PKR 57,999. That makes Tecno Camon 19 Pro cheaper by PKR 8,000. Retail prices move often, so treat these as indicative.
Tecno Camon 19 Pro scores higher in our camera assessment. Tecno Camon 19 Pro uses a 64 MP main sensor against 8 MP on Vivo Y50i, though sensor size and processing matter more than resolution alone.
Tecno Camon 19 Pro leads on battery. Tecno Camon 19 Pro carries a 5000 mAh cell and Vivo Y50i a 5000 mAh cell, with 33W and 10W wired charging respectively.
